Description
This is a 1793 WREATH CENT, LETTERED EDGE, S-11C – NGC XF DETAILS CORROSION, PLEASING LOOK. An evenly struck first-year Wreath Cent with strong details and rich medium-brown surfaces. The rims are problem-free and there are none of the usual marks, scratches or large planchet defects often found on 1793 Cents. The surfaces have some very light areas of porosity, more evident on the reverse than the obverse. The light porosity, however, does not greatly detract from the coin’s overall pleasing appearance.
